Red Velvet Cheesecake Brownies For the Red Velvet Brownie Layer: - 1 cup (225g) unsalted butter - 3 tbsp (20g) natural cocoa powder - 1 tsp (5g) vanilla extract - 1/2 cup (100g) light brown sugar - 1 3/4 cups (350g) powdered sugar - 3/4 cup (120g) semi-sweet chocolate chips - 1/3 cup (60g) semi-sweet chocolate, chopped - 3 large eggs, room temperature - 3/4 cup (90g) all-purpose flour - Pinch of salt - 3 tbsp (45g) olive oil - 1 1/2 tsp (7g) gel red food coloring - 1 teaspoon (5g) white vinegar For the Cheesecake Layer: - 8 oz (225g) cream cheese, room temperature - 1/4 cup (50g) granulated sugar - 1 tsp (5g) cornstarch - 1/2 tsp (2g) vanilla extract - 2 tbsp (30g) sour cream, room temperature - 1 large egg, room temperature Method: 1. Preheat oven to 175°C / 350°F. Grease and line an 8x8 inch pan with parchment paper. 2. Prepare Cream Cheese Layer: Whisk cream cheese, egg, vanilla, and sugar until smooth. 3. Prepare Brownie Layer: Brown butter in a saucepan over medium-low heat, stirring every 10 seconds. Once milk solids from butter sink and turn golden brown, transfer to heatproof bowl. Add cocoa powder, oil, vanilla, and chopped chocolate; mix until dissolved. Add vinegar and food color. Mix and let the mixture cool at room temperature for 15-20 minutes. Whisk eggs and light brown sugar (for 4-6 minutes) until dissolved and mixture turns into a light pale color. Add powdered sugar; mix until combined (1-2 minutes). Combine egg mixture with browned butter mixture; mix until combined. Add flour and chocolate chips. Mix until just combined; avoid overmixing. Transfer half of the brownie mixture to the prepared pan. Reserve 30g / 2-3 tbsp of the cream cheese mixture; add the remaining mixture on top of the brownie layer. Top with the remaining brownie batter; add the reserved cream cheese mixture. Make swirls. Bake for 35-40 minutes or until the edges are golden and the center is slightly fudgy. Let cool completely before cutting. Tips: - Dissolve sugar in eggs for a crackly top. - Avoid overmixing. - Adjust baking time as needed.
